Popular African Names
The world of African names is a tapestry of diverse cultures‚ each with its own unique traditions and naming practices. Here are some popular African names that have gained recognition for their beauty‚ meaning‚ and cultural significance⁚
- Aisha (Arabic origin‚ widely used in Africa)⁚ Meaning "living" or "alive‚" Aisha is a popular and beloved name across various African cultures.
- Amani (Swahili origin)⁚ Meaning "peace" or "hope‚" Amani is a beautiful and meaningful name that embodies a sense of tranquility and optimism.
- Boluwatife (Yoruba origin)⁚ Meaning "God is merciful‚" Boluwatife is a powerful name that expresses gratitude and faith.
- Chukwudi (Igbo origin)⁚ Meaning "God is great‚" Chukwudi is a name that celebrates the divine and inspires awe.
- Kofi (Akan origin)⁚ Meaning "born on Friday‚" Kofi is a popular name in Ghana and other parts of West Africa.
- Zuri (Swahili origin)⁚ Meaning "beautiful‚" Zuri is a captivating name that embodies elegance and grace.
These are just a few examples of the many beautiful and meaningful names found in African cultures. Explore further to uncover the rich diversity of names that await you.
